Пользовательские сценарии, в отличие от пользовательской документации, нужны не для пользователя, а для разработчика. Когда клиент подъезжает на автомобиле для замены резины, система сама определяет и накачивает шину до нужного атмосферного давления. Проверить корректность работы системы мы можем с помощью манометра, его и нужно указать в разделе. Математическое обеспечение системы — это математические модели и алгоритмы, которые исполнитель будет использовать. Здесь могут быть ранее не прописанные вами алгоритмы вычислений, к которым пришёл исполнитель в процессе изучения ТЗ.
Расскажите О Проекте — Мы Его Реализуем
Для каждой записи в списке должна быть возможность начать обзвон. Возможность управления набором филиалов – редактирование / удаление / создание новых филиалов. Для филиалов должна быть возможность управления набором районов — редактирование / удаление / создание новых районов. Значения из этого набора используются в карточках клиентов.
Почему Тз — Это Важно
Без этой информации невозможно создать сайт, который будет решать вашу бизнес-задачу. Компания приходит https://deveducation.com/ за разработкой с конкретными требованиями к цифровому продукту. Причём требования могут составлять разные подразделения — технические специалисты, команда маркетинга, аналитики, коммерции. Цифровое решение должно объединять и выполнять все эти требования. Благодаря ТЗ вся полученная информация выстраивается в чёткие задачи и фиксируется в документе. Техническое задание — это инструмент, который помогает разработке цифрового решения.
В результате заказчику пришлось заключить дополнительное соглашение и доплатить за передачу кода, что увеличило бюджет на 20%. Спор был урегулирован, но задержал запуск портала на 2 месяца. Юрист разрабатывает гибкий механизм внесения изменений, чтобы учесть динамику проекта без нарушения договорных обязательств.
SRS это спецификация требований для определенного программного изделия, программы или набора программ (продукт), которые выполняют определенные функции в конкретном окружении. Из определения следует, что это аналог ТЗ, описанного в ГОСТ 19, а по структуре очень напоминает SRS из стандарта IEEE 830. На самом деле новичку достаточно трудно понять, что должно содержаться в данных разделах по вышеприведенной структуре (как и в случае с ГОСТом), поэтому нужно читать сам стандарт, который легко найти в Интернете. Размещение контента — ещё один вопрос, который прописывается в ТЗ. Одна компания-разработчик самостоятельно добавляет контент на сайт, другая оставляет шаблонный текст, а корректный контент размещает Интеграционное тестирование клиент, третья обучает клиента добавлению и корректировке контента.
Цель статьи — предоставить практическое руководство по созданию ТЗ, которое будет технически точным, юридически надежным и понятным для всех сторон. Статья рассчитана на широкий круг читателей, включая тех, кто впервые сталкивается с разработкой IT-продукта. Во-первых, техническое задание – это, как правило, основной документ в рамках проектной документации. Таким образом, техническое задание — это не только технический, но и юридический документ, от качества которого зависит успех IT-проекта. Юристы из компании «Saenko Group» превратят его в надежный инструмент, который минимизирует риски и защищает интересы всех сторон. Их профессионализм обеспечивает четкость формулировок, соответствие документа законодательным нормам, а также предотвращает споры по вопросам сроков, качества или прав на продукт.
Все попытки формализовать процесс и создать универсальный пример технического задания на разработку программного обеспечения всегда оборачивались спиральным движением к пример тз на разработку программного обеспечения цели. Если нужно разработать технически сложный продукт, который предполагает серьёзное финансирование, лучше составить подробное ТЗ с указанием всех важных требований. То же касается технического задания для творческих проектов — например, дизайнерские задачи важно зафиксировать, чтобы исполнитель точно сделал то, что нужно заказчику. В целом, составление ТЗ – это достаточно сложная и ответственная задача, но грамотно составленное техническое задание – это уже половина успеха разрабатываемого проекта. Поэтому в процессе разработки ТЗ на ПО вы должны проявить максимальную внимательность и осведомленность в технических и организационных вопросах.
Требования К Структуре И Функционированию Системы
- Цель статьи — предоставить практическое руководство по созданию ТЗ, которое будет технически точным, юридически надежным и понятным для всех сторон.
- В этой части нашего цикла статей про создание IT-концепции рассказываем про стандарты и шаблоны для ТЗ на разработку программного обеспечения.
- Следующий этап — описать, как пользователи будут двигаться по сайту.
- Третья часть — гистограмма распределения звонков и посещений по часам.
Список представляет собой таблицу с датой, типом обращения, типом клиента, менеджером, направлением, информацией об автомобиле, информацией о клиенте, этапом, статусом, комментарием. Должна быть возможность фильтрации по любому полю, выбора временного интервала, поиска. В рамках методологии Глаголии, разработка технического задания на выполнение ПО — это обязательный этап, который следует за аналитикой и предшествует проектированию архитектуры. Технический проект может меняться по мере появления новых данных, но ТЗ должно оставаться стабильной точкой отсчёта. Каждый этап трансформации строится таким образом, чтобы максимально избежать жесткости конечных конструкций, обеспечить динамичное уточнение каждого элемента, данного, объекта, функции и пр.
Однако, случается и так, что для внесения правок нужно затронуть архитектуру и переписать уже готовый функционал. Время, затраченное на введение такой фичи в процессе разработки больше, чем если бы вы указали её сразу в ТЗ. Второй сценарий — это когда вы работаете с нормальным подрядчиком, но из-за нечетких требований в ТЗ вы с исполнителем встречаетесь с недопониманием, что в результате влияет на конечный вид системы.
Прежде чем приступать к написанию документации, важно чётко понимать, что такое техническое задание на разработку ПО, и как оно соотносится с другими терминами — особенно с техническим проектом. Эти два документа часто путают, хотя их назначение принципиально различается. Опишем с вами одну страницу, где будет отображаться список проектов. Обратите внимание, что мы описываем структуру ТЗ по нашему шаблону. Наше ТЗ — гибрид из стандарта по ГОСТу и собственных предпочтений. Можно сказать, что этот шаблон — тот документ, который мы видим у «идеального» заказчика.
Без него сложно представить качественную разработку программного обеспечения. Правильно составленное ТЗ поможет вам сэкономить время, бюджет и нервы. Например, если мы готовим техническое задание на разработку по образцу, предоставленному заказчиком, то первым делом проверяем его соответствие этим критериям. Зачастую документ содержит обобщённые формулировки вроде «удобный интерфейс» или «быстрая работа», которые невозможно проверить или реализовать без дополнительных уточнений. Мы помогаем заказчику конкретизировать такие требования, чтобы они стали основой для технической реализации. Такой подход позволяет выстраивать универсальную структуру требований, применимую как для госзаказов, так и для коммерческих IT-проектов.
На другом сайте нравится дизайн — прикрепите скрин. На третьем сайте нравится вёрстка — снова скрин. Чем наглядней будет представлена задача, тем легче её реализовать. Техническое задание облегчает коммуникацию между заказчиком и исполнителем, а в спорных ситуациях позволяет обратиться к прописанным в ТЗ требованиям, чтобы разрешить ситуацию. Лучшее решение — если техническое задание станет приложением к основному договору.
Leave a Reply